What I don't know is how deep can you go before you hit water?

Has anybody drilled an 8BA block to match the earlier 32-48 bolt holes - I have not. Do the castings have the necessary "boss" material around these bolt locations, or are you really drilling into thinner material that may not be thick enough for your planned tapping operations?

Once or if you hit water, then all the filing are going into the water jackets . . . just causing more rust/crap to sit in the bottom of them. If it was mine (and I hit water), then I would put short studs in these holes with good thread sealer on them.

If the casting does not have boss material, or is not thick enough to support a decent thread depth (and associated torque), then there may not be any value in doing this.
